The 2020 Nando’s Hot Young Designer (HYD) finalists have been announced, as part of the brand’s biannual search for up-and-coming talent.
The aim of the competition (in its third iteration) is to celebrate young creatives and provide a platform for them to showcase their designs and help launch their careers.
The brief for this year was to create a unique bench that adheres to the notion of social distancing, while being both aesthetically pleasing and inviting.
A panel of eight judges included Thabisa Mjo of Mash T Design Studio and Mpho Vackier of The Urbanative, who were jointly awarded Designer of the Year at the 2019 100% Design South Africa Awards; VISI Editor Steve Smith; VISI Editor-at-Large Annemarie Meintjies; Creative Director Tracy Lynch of Studio Leelynch and the Nando’s Design Programme; Editor Malibongwe Tyilo of the Nando’s Design Programme; Art Director Jo Skelton of the Nando’s Design Programme; and Michael Spinks, Property and Development Director for Nando’s.
This year’s submissions featured such a high standard of work that there was a tie for one of the places, while another entry came in from two jointly responsible designers, leaving the total number of finalists at 12, instead of the usual 10.

The overall winner will be announced at Constitution Hill after the finalists attend a mentorship event in November 2020, where leading designers will share their tips, skills and insights.
